Here are some answers for you:
Are those of us who served but didn't serve in combat be eligible since it's VFW or is this only reserved for its members? It is open to everyone, both veterans and non-veterans. The jobs are advertised on VetJobs which is sponsored by the VFW (actually own 10%) and endorsed by many veteran service organizations like the MOPH, VVA, SVA, AUSN, NGAUS, etc. Is this restricted to honorable service or are those who messed up and got a General, OTH or BC discharge welcome to apply?
Anyone who would be eligible to work in Canada can apply

Is the VFW going to help push the paperwork or help pay for getting a passport?
No, the VFW is advertising the openings through VetJobs (www.vetjobs.com), a military job board in which they own 10%. VetJobs purpose over the last 13 years has been to get veterans, their spouses and children qulaity employment.

Do vets even need a passport to get hired to begin with?
You can visit Canada on your drivers license or a military ID card, but to stay and work I believe you need a visa.
